Protein containers, polynucleotides, vectors, expression cassettes, cells, methods for producing containers, methods for identifying pathogens or diagnosing diseases, uses of containers, and diagnostic kits
The present invention relates to a protein container into which various exogenous polyamino acid sequences can be simultaneously inserted for expression in various systems and for various uses. The present invention relates to polynucleotides which can produce the above-mentioned protein containers. The present invention also relates to vectors and expression cassettes comprising the above-mentioned polynucleotides. The present invention also relates to cells comprising the above-mentioned vectors or expression cassettes. The present invention also relates to methods for producing said protein containers and identifying pathogens or diagnosing diseases in vitro. The present invention also relates to the use of said protein container and a kit comprising said protein container for diagnosis or as a vaccine composition.
